30th Blacksmith Festival: Where Glowing Iron, Museum Flair, and Family Joy Come Together
On August 15, 2026, the Technology Museum Forge in Zella-Mehlis will transform into a lively meeting place for all who love real craftsmanship, industrial culture, and summer festival atmosphere. The Blacksmith Festival is firmly established as a traditional event in the museum calendar and delights with blacksmith demonstrations, machine displays, flea markets, children's games, music, and culinary offerings. Entrance is free. ([oberzentrum-suedthueringen.de](https://oberzentrum-suedthueringen.de/events/29-schmiedefest/?utm_source=openai))
Tradition with Spark
The Technology Museum Forge stands for lived industrial history. In the historic site, blacksmith culture is not only presented but made tangible: hammers, fire, and machines make the work of the forge vividly experienceable for visitors. The Blacksmith Festival connects directly to this, blending the artisanal tradition with a family-friendly multi-day feeling that is compact yet intense. Getting There, Grounds, and Accessibility
The Technology Museum is located at Lubenbachstraße 4 in 98544 Zella-Mehlis. Parking is provided for visitors at the technology museum, and the museum is mostly accessible. Arriving by car via the A71 is quite feasible. ([museen.thueringen.de](https://www.museen.thueringen.de/museum/DE-MUS-463010?utm_source=openai))
